Output 95ed8816ee5ddc6f9a66849efc112f03df94d47cf5a479e53d2ab1a98ff850fa:0

value
3263995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59e1f8a7f231c5e39b0e1d88fb72cf75bafbdf6 OP_EQUAL
address
3Q5iu8oCYzN13n1AnWTnZ7qFWfHvQ73UXH
transaction
95ed8816ee5ddc6f9a66849efc112f03df94d47cf5a479e53d2ab1a98ff850fa
spent
true